, probably in the walls of the alveoli, when stimulated they produce apnea (= stoppage of respiration) followed by hyperpnea. bradyeardia and hypotension In addition. 11 can also produce bronchospasm Further, stmulation of J receptors Ie ads to the inhibition of contraction of the skeletal muscles Therefore. J reflex = stimulation of J receptor bradycardia + hypotension + hyperpnea + weakness of skeletal muscles When are these receptors stimulated? Answer is, it is slimulaied in pathological conditions like, (i) sma emboh in the pulmonary blood vessels and (ii) pulmonary edema J receptors and muscular exercise What causes the physical exhaustion and muscular fatigua during a hard exercise is not clearly known (In general, it is believed that fatigue in intact man is caused by central mechanism, ie . mechanism residing in the synapses of the central nervous system) Paintil argued that during muscular exercise. cungestion of the pulmonary capillaries lead to slight accumulation of interstitial fluid (recall, at health during rest, the pulmonary interstium is dry) this in turn Ie ads to stimulation of J receptors muscular weakness Teteologically, this may be viewed as a naturally exsting 'brake'mechanism in the body, operating to prevent excessive exercise However, paintals vews regarding the cause of muscular weakness in physical exercise is yei to be univsrsally agreed
